| York
International offers a number of programs aimed at allowing
all York students to internationalize their degree without leaving Canada. From the annual Emerging Global Leaders
Program (EGLP), the weekly radioshow Kaleidoscope, there's something for every York student wanting to do something international, without leaving Canada.
